  Sandcastle V.I. - Spaceflight Directory - Soyuz Flight Details 6
During a visit by the crew of Soyuz TM-3, Laveykin returned to Earth after experiencing irregular heartbeats.
Alexandrov, of the Soyuz TM-3 crew, remained aboard Mir with Romanenko.
Mission Highlights: This short duration mission aboard Mir served as an ambulance to return the ailing Laveykin of the Soyuz TM-2 crew to Earth.

 Soyuz TM
Carried Yuri Romanenko, Aleksander Laveykin to Mir; returned Laveykin, crew of Soyuz TM-3 to Earth.
Transported to the Mir orbital space station a Soviet-Syrian crew comprising cosmonauts A S Viktorenko, A P Aleksandrov and M A Faris to conduct joint research and experiments with cosmonauts Y Romanenko and A Laveykin.
Carried Alexander Volkov, Sergei Krikalev, Jean-Loup Chretien to Mir; returned Volkov, Krikalev to Earth.

 Mir: A Rich Chronology
Apparently, it was left behind by a Progress cargo ship previously docked to the port and used as a trash container at the end of its mission.
On February 1, 1990, during a spacewalk, Alexander Serebrov dons an experimental flying armchair that had been delivered to Mir with Kvant 2.
Unlike U.S. astronauts, who flew untethered flights with a similar device, the Soviet cosmonaut remains attached to the station with a safety tether, since there is no space shuttle to pick him up in case of an emergency.
